Berkshire Hathaway Inc. (NYSE:BRK-A – Get Free Report)’s stock price traded up 0.6% during trading on Wednesday . The company traded as high as $622,658.50 and last traded at $622,658.50. 2,141 shares were traded during trading, The stock had previously closed at $618,999.90.
Berkshire Hathaway Stock Performance
The business has a 50 day simple moving average of $617,848.94 and a 200 day simple moving average of $604,107.03.

About Berkshire Hathaway
Berkshire Hathaway Inc, through its subsidiaries, engages in the insurance, freight rail transportation, and utility businesses worldwide. The company provides property, casualty, life, accident, and health insurance and reinsurance; and operates railroad systems in North America. It also generates, transmits, stores, and distributes electricity from natural gas, coal, wind, solar, hydroelectric, nuclear, and geothermal sources; operates natural gas distribution and storage facilities, interstate pipelines, liquefied natural gas facilities, and compressor and meter stations; and holds interest in coal mining assets.
